Are you off your game?
Just as your physical health can change so can our mental wellbeing. Every year, one in four of us faces a mental health challenge and in any given week, one in six experiences a common mental health problem such as anxiety or depression. These odds mean we all know someone affected, and that not feeling great is common.
Sometimes through lack of understanding we shy away from talking about our mental health challenges, but if we don’t talk about it and ask for help when we need it, they can get very serious. So, if you are struggling try and talk to someone you trust, whether that’s a family member, friend or doctor, or if you don’t want to talk to someone you know there are organisations you can contact such as MIND, SHOUT and the Samaritans.
